首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往
您找到你想要的搜索结果了吗?
是的
没有找到

构建ASP.NET MVC4+EF5+EasyUI+Unity2.x注入的后台管理系统(8)-MVC与EasyUI DataGrid 分页

前言 为了符合后面更新的重构系统,文章于2016-11-1日重写 EasyUI Datagrid加载的时候会提交一些分页的信息到后台,我们需要根据这些信息来进行数据分页再次返回到前台 实现 首先要让...默认[10,20,30,40,50] 排序字段:sortName 默认null 排序类型:sortOrder 默认asc OK加入的代码变成这样 $(function () {...实际已经分页,但是不正确的,每一页的数据一样。我们要根据分页的参数去取 查看技巧 ?...return Rep.IsExist(id); } } }  我们要在BLL层返回当前查询的全部条数,还要返回当前页得数据 补脑:ref关键字使参数引用传递...其效果是,当控制权传递回调用方法时,方法中对参数所做的任何更改都将反映在该变量中。若要使用ref参数,则方法定义和调用方法都必须显式使用ref关键字。

1.2K70

mysql数据库(排序分页

排序数据 1.1 排序规则 使用 ORDER BY 子句排序 ASC(ascend): 升序 DESC(descend):降序 ORDER BY 子句SELECT语句的结尾。...FROM employees ORDER BY salary; #如果没有ODER BY 指明排序方式,则默认按照升序排序 SELECT employee_id, name, salary FROM...employees ORDER BY salary DESC; 1.我们也可以使用的别名,给别名进行排序 # 我们可以使用的别名,进行排序 SELECT employee_id, name, salary...在对多进行排序的时候,首先排序的第一必须有相同的值,才会对第二进行排序。如果第一数据中所有值都是唯一的,将不再对第二进行排序。...如果我们知道返回结果只有1 条,就可以使用 LIMIT 1 ,告诉 SELECT 语句只需要返回一条记录即可。

8010

日常问题:MySQL排序字段数据相同不能分页问题

【问题日期】 2022-11-14 22:45:12 【问题描述】 MySQL 排序字段数据相同不能分页问题:分页查询数据时,创建时间排序,由于数据是批量创建的,导致部分数据创建时间一样,而此时分页查询数据...,翻页出现重复数据 【问题拆解】 分页查询数据 按照创建时间排序&存在创建时间相同的数据 翻页出现重复数据 【问题来源】 朋友遇到的 【可能原因】 是因为排序字段只有创建时间 【参考链接】 MySQL...如果多行在中具有相同的值 ORDER BY,则服务器可以自由地以任何顺序返回这些行,并且可能会根据整体执行计划以不同的方式返回。换句话说,这些行的排序顺序对于无序的是不确定的。...【解决方案】 可以 order by 后面加上一个唯一的 id 【问题总结】 如果多行在中具有相同的值 ORDER BY,则服务器可以自由地以任何顺序返回这些行,并且可能会根据整体执行计划以不同的方式返回... MySQL 5.7.33 之前,无法覆盖此行为,即使使用其他优化可能更快的情况下也是如此。

1.7K40

MySQL排序分页详解

排序数据 排序规则 单列排序排序 2. 分页 分页原理 拓展 练习题 1....排序数据 排序规则 使用 ORDER BY 子句排序 ASC(ascend): 升序 DESC(descend):降序 ORDER BY 子句SELECT语句的结尾。...在对多进行排序的时候,首先排序的第一必须有相同的值,才会对第二进行排序。如果第一数据中所有值都是唯一的,将不再对第二进行排序。 2....使用 LIMIT 的好处 约束返回结果的数量可以减少数据表的网络传输量,也可以提升查询效率 。如果我们知道返回结果只有1条,就可以使用 LIMIT 1,告诉 SELECT 语句只需要返回一条记录即可。...拓展 不同的 DBMS 中使用的关键字可能不同。MySQL、PostgreSQL、MariaDB 和 SQLite 中使用 LIMIT 关键字,而且需要放到 SELECT 语句的最后面。

1.9K60

Oracle中rownum的基本用法

Oracle中的rownum的是取数据的时候产生的序号,所以想对指定排序的数据去指定的rowmun行数据就必须注意了。...排序,并且用rownum标出正确序号(有小到大) 笔者在工作中有一上百万条记录的表,jsp页面中需对该表进行分页显示,便考虑用rownum来作,下面是具体方法(每页显示20条): “select *...from tabname where rownum<20 order by name" 但却发现oracle却不能自己的意愿来执行,而是先随便取20条记录,然后再order by,经咨询oracle...经笔者试验,只需order by 的字段上加主键或索引即可让oracle先按该字段排序,然后再rownum;方法不变: “select * from tabname where rownum<...var 为1 的时候才满足条件,这个时候不存在 stop key ,必须进行full scan ,对每个满足其他where条件的数据进行判定,选出一行才能去选rownum=2的行…… 分页查询语句:

6.1K30

《Spring Boot 入门及前后端分离项目实践》系列介绍

第11课:Spring Boot 项目实践之 RESTful API 设计与实现 第12课:Spring Boot 项目实践之登录模块实现 第13课:Spring Boot 项目实践之分页功能实现 第...14课:Spring Boot 项目实践之 jqgrid 分页整合 第15课:Spring Boot 项目实践之用户编辑功能实现 第16课:Spring Boot 项目实践之用户管理模块实现 第17课:...列表页面(分页功能) ? 图片上传功能 ? 富文本编辑器整合使用 ?...全局异常处理; 前后端分离详解; AJAX 异步技术; AdminLTE3、Bootstrap 4、SweetAlert、JqGrid、JQuery 等前端框架组件及控件的使用; Spring Boot...项目开发流程; 前后端分离项目开发实践; Spring Boot 完整的 web 项目源码及开发流程; 熟悉我的朋友应该都知道,我写教程时一般都是“文章”+“源码”+“演示网站”同时提供的,因此课程完结

91810

数据库——排序分页

目录 排序数据 单列排序排列 分页   分页原理 优点  MySQL 8.0新特性 排序数据 使用 ORDER BY 子句排序 ASC(ascend): 升序 DESC(descend):降序 ORDER...BY 子句SELECT语句的结尾。...ASC; # 升序排列,结果差不多,就不展示了,默认升序排列 运行结果如下所示:         还可以使用的别名来排序,具体如下所示: SELECT employee_id,last_name...如果我们知道返回结果只有 1 条,就可以使用 LIMIT 1 ,告诉 SELECT 语句只需要返回一条记录即可。...MySQL中使用 LIMIT 实现分页 格式: LIMIT [位置偏移量,] 行数         第一个“位置偏移量”参数指示MySQL从哪一行开始显示,是一个可选参数,如果不指定“位置偏移 量

46820

springboot第60集:架构师万字挑战,一文让你走出微服务迷雾架构周刊

根据当前数值,t_score_0排队列的最后一位。 之前队列中 排名第二的t_score_2的数据结果集则自动排在了队列首位。...每一次数据结果集当前游标的下移都需要将该数据结果集重新放入优先级队列排序, 而只有排列队列首位的数据结果集才可能发生游标下移的操作。...流式分组归并要求SQL的排序项与分组项的字段以及排序类型(ASC或DESC)必须保持一致,否则只能 通过内存归并才能保证其数据的正确性。...求平均值的聚合函数只有AVG。它必须通过SQL改写的SUM和COUNT进行计算 所有归并类型都可能进行分页。...ShardingSphere的分页功能比较容易让使用者误解,用户通常认为分页归并会占用大量内存。

11010

mysql索引十连问| 剑指offer - mysql

索引使用场景 where 为查询条件字段创建索引,以达到快速过滤指定条件数据的目的。 order by 当使用 order by 将查询结果某个字段排序时,可考虑为该字段创建索引。...没有索引时,会先将查询结果放到内存中进行排序(若内存空间不足,会利用磁盘辅助排序),比较影响查询效率。索引本身是有序的,可以直接索引的顺序逐条回表取出数据即可。...如果是分页查询,效果更好,这时候只需要取出某个范围的索引对应的数据,而不需要取出所有满足条件的数据排序再截取返回分页数据。...模糊查询时查询条件以”%” 开头无法使用到索引 使用 or 查询时,只有当所有的查询条件字段都有索引才能使用到,比如 a=1 or b = 2, 只有当 a 和 b 都有索引才能使用到索引。...一般出现在全表数据比较少的情况下,这时全表扫描比非主键索引上查找再回表速度可能更快。 联合索引时,查找不满足最左匹配规则,无法使用到联合索引。

87820

{dede:list}和{dede:arclist}的区别

senddate、pubdate、id、click、lastpost、postnum ,默认为 sortrank pagesize='20' 分页大小,调用文章条数 一般列表页会增加一个分页代码{dede...功能说明:获取指定文档列表 适用范围:全局使用 基本语法: {dede:arclist  flag='h' typeid='' row='' col='' titlelen='' infolen='...多方式显示 row='10' 返回文档列表总数 typeid='' 栏目ID,列表模板和档案模板中一般不需要指定,首页模板中允许用","分开表示多个栏目; getall='1' 没有指定这属性的情况下...='near' § orderby=='lastpost' 最后评论时间 § orderby=='scores' 得分排序 § orderby='id' 文章ID排序 § orderby='rand...,默认为降序 subday='天数' 表示多少天以内的文档

3.6K60

redis拾遗 原

,下标从0开始,-1代表最后一个元素,如zrang array 0 10 若要同时获取分数,命令最后加上withscores zrevrange 分数从大到小获取某个范围的元素列表,下标从0开始... array 50 90,若要同时获取分数,命令最后加上withscores,若要分页查询,命令加limit,用法同sql中的limit一样 zrevrangebyscore 获取指定分数范围内从大到小顺序的元素...,如zrangebyscore array 50 90,若要同时获取分数,命令最后加上withscores,若要分页查询,命令加limit,用法同sql中的limit一样,此命令参数第一个参数是最大值...,遍历所有的值进行排序     sort key by key*->列名 desc get key*->title 按照key*键中的列名的值排序,*是拿key中的值进行替换,遍历所有的值进行排序,...管理篇 bind 绑定ip,使指定ip的主机才能连接 密码 配置文件里配置requirepass属性,注意这里可用穷举法破解,使用命令时需要先用auth 密码认证 命令命名 配置文件里使用rename-command

1K20

jquery datatable 参数

以下是进行dataTable绑定处理时候可以附加的参数: 属性名称 取值范围 解释 bAutoWidth true or false, default true 是否自动计算表格各宽度 bDeferRender...true or false, default true 开关,是否显示(使用分页器 bProcessing true or false, defualt false 开关,以指定当正在处理数据的时候...当这个标志为true的时候,分页器就默认关闭 bSort true or false, default true 开关,是否让各具有排序功能 bSortClasses true or false,...default true 开关,指定当当前列排序时,是否增加classes 'sorting_1', 'sorting_2' and 'sorting_3',打开处理大数据时,性能有所损失 bStateSave...是否开启垂直滚动,以及指定滚动区域大小 -- -- -- 选项 aaSorting array array[int,string], 如[], [[0,'asc'], [0,'desc']] 指定数据排序的依据

17810

MySQL:DQL 数据查询语句盘点

本篇内容包括:DQL 的简介、SELECT 语句、WHERE 条件语句、JOIN 连接查询(多表查询)和分组、过滤、排序分页、子查询的使用。...] # 指定查询记录一个或多个条件排序 [LIMIT { [offset,]row_count | row_count OFFSET offset}]; #指定查询的记录从哪条至哪条 PS...分组的依据字段可以有多个,并依次分组 与HAVING结合使用,进行分组的数据筛选 GROUP BY的语句顺序WHERE后面,ORDER BY 的前面 通常在对数据使用计算统计的时候,会用到GROUP...SELECT语句中,GROUP BY分组之后再进行条件筛选,就不能使用WHERE,而是GROUP BY后面通过HAVING进行分组的条件筛选。HAVING的作用等同于WHERE。...对 SELECT 语句查询得到的结果,某些字段进行排序 与DESC 或 ASC搭配使用,默认为 ASC ASC 为升序排列,DESC 为降序排列 4、LIMIT 分页显示,对用户体验、网络传输、查询压力上都有好处

1.5K20

工作中必会的57个Excel小技巧

A:F,输入回车即可自动跳转 5、设置三栏表头 插入 -形状 -直线 -拖入文本框中输入的字体并把边框设置为无 6、同时编辑多个工作表 ctrl或shift键选取多个工作表,直接编辑当前工作表即可....N,然后再复制该序号到下面空行,最后按序号排序即可。...11、插入特殊符号 插入 -符号 12、查找重复值 选取数据 -开始 -条件格式 -突出显示单元格规则 -重复值 13、删除重复值 选取区域 -数据 -删除重复项 14、单元格分区域需要密码才能编辑...审阅 -允许用户编辑区域 15、用excel进行汉英互译 审阅 -翻释 16、不复制隐藏的行 选取区域 - ctrl+g定位 -定位条件 -可见单元格 -复制 -粘贴 17、单元格强制换行 需要换行字符...2、多页强制打印到一页上 页面布局 -打印标题 -页面 -调整为1页宽1页高 3、厘米设置行高 视图 -页面布局,页面布局下行高单位是厘米 4、插入分页符 选取要插入的位置 -页面布局 -分页符 -

4K30

Oracle优化之单表分页优化

如,下面的sql (没有过滤条件,只有排序),要将查询结果分页显示,每页显示10条,如: select * from t_test order by object_id; 例子: 1、分页查询sql语句...(因为索引已经排序了,可使用索引来消除排序)一般分页语句中都有排序。...这是因为第一条sql的过滤条件where owner='SCOTT',表中只有很少数据,通过扫描object_id的索引,然后回表去匹配owner='SCOTT',因为owner='SCOTT'数据量很少...如果分页语句中排序只有一个,但是是降序显示的,创建索引的时候就没必要降序创建索引了,我们可以使用hint:index_desc 让索引降序扫描就可以了。...注意:   ①:如果分页语句中有排序(order by),要利用索引已经排序的特性,将order by的按照排序的先后顺序包含在索引中,同时要注意排序是升序还是降序。

87510

SQL优化篇:如何成为一位写优质SQL语句的绝顶高手!

,接着是需要按照排序好的ID,将对应的姓名顺序显示出来,在这里第一时间有小伙伴可能想到的是嵌套子查询,使用in来做,如下: select user_name from zz_users where user_id...如果表中有相关的索引,MySQL可以快速确定在数据文件中间找到的位置,而不需要查看所有的数据。这比顺序读取每一行要快得多。 大多数MySQL索引(主键、唯一、索引和全文)都存储b-tree中。...⑤对于非二进制字符串列之间的比较,这两应该使用相同的字符集。 ⑥如果在可用索引的最左边的前缀上进行排序或分组(例如,key_part1,key_part2排序),则表被排序或分组。...⑦某些情况下,MySQL可以使用索引来满足order by子句,并避免执行文件排序操作时涉及的额外排序。 ⑧某些情况下,查询可以被优化,以检索值而不查询数据行。...只有InnoDB和MyISAM存储引擎支持全文本索引,并且只支持char、varchar和text。索引总是整个列上,并且不支持前缀索引。

56840
领券